We thought maybe it was due to callous buildup so he (against his desire) went for a pedicure. No change. Any tips, advice? PS. Yes, this is serious. [&:] Does your husband's feet sweat a lot? If so, he might have a condition similar to mine. My feet get very sweaty and tend to stink something horrible (my wife used to tell me that they could "gag a maggot"). I actually saw my doctor about it. He said that some people just have hyperactive sweat glands in their feet, and so they perspire more. His recommendations were to bathe my feet more often (if you have one of those foot massagers where you dip your feet into the water and let the air-jets run, that's great) and to go without socks more often so that my feet could air out and dry up. I wear sandles a lot in the summer, now (which feels great), and go without socks around the house in the winter. The odor problem has cleared up considerably for me. (Thank God, because I think my wife was actually considering using a chain saw on my lower legs.) Another thing that I've heard is that diet can affect how much you sweat and body odor. I don't know how much stock to put in this, but does your husband eat a lot of spicy foods?
